Inspection
During an AC tune-up, the HVAC technician performs a thorough inspection of the entire air conditioning system, including the indoor and outdoor units, refrigerant levels, electrical components, thermostat calibration, air filter, condensate drain line, and energy efficiency. The inspection aims to identify any existing or potential issues, improve efficiency, enhance indoor air quality, and ensure the system operates at peak performance and safety.
Cleaning
During an AC tune-up, key components like the condenser coil, condensate drain, and AC filter are thoroughly inspected and cleaned. The condenser coil, located in the outdoor unit, is cleaned to remove dirt and debris, improving heat transfer for better cooling efficiency. The condensate drain line is checked for clogs and cleaned to prevent water leaks and mold growth. Additionally, the AC filter is replaced to enhance indoor air quality and ensure proper airflow, contributing to efficient system performance and a healthier living environment.
Testing
During an AC tune-up, the technician takes common measurements to assess the air conditioning system’s performance and efficiency. They measure temperature differentials, airflow, refrigerant pressure, electrical amperage, thermostat calibration, voltage, and condensate drain flow rate. These measurements help ensure the system operates optimally, providing efficient cooling, preventing issues, and maintaining a comfortable indoor environment.

Frequently Asked Questions
For optimal performance, it is recommended to have your air conditioner serviced twice yearly – once in the spring and once in the fall.
This will help ensure that your air conditioner is running efficiently and that any potential problems are caught and addressed before they become more serious.
Regular AC maintenance includes regularly scheduled filter changes and condenser & evaporator coil cleaning, ensuring your system is getting proper air flow for optimal operation.
This helps to keep your system running efficiently and can help to extend the life of your AC unit.
You should have your AC serviced every year, ideally in early to mid-spring. A maintenance appointment typically takes 1-2 hours and can help keep your AC unit running smoothly and efficiently.
Regular maintenance can help you avoid costly repairs and can even extend the life of your AC unit. It’s important to have a professional technician inspect your unit to ensure that it is working properly.
On average, air conditioners can last between 10-20 years, with most lasting around 10-15 years. Usage and local climate can affect the lifespan, as well as the type of AC and insulation.
Proper maintenance is essential to ensure that your AC unit lasts as long as possible. Regularly cleaning the filters and coils, and scheduling annual maintenance checks can help extend the life of your AC.
